似乎IE不允许直接打开blob.你必须使用msSaveOrOpenBlob.但有什么方法可以转换它.我确实需要在没有下载的情况下将PDF显示到IE的新选项卡中,或者至少用户不应该进行交互,并且不会将其下载到例如IE中.系统临时文件夹. Safai在同一个窗口打开它而不是新标签,但主要问题是IE.使所有浏览器工作的主要思路相似,并在新选项卡中打开它以进行预览.let blob = new Blob([response], {type: 'application/pdf' });if (window.navigator && wind...
$('.menu div.profile-btn').on('click', function () {$('.mainservice-page').fadeIn(1200); }上面的脚本成功打开了div .mainservice-page的内容,但是我想在新的选项卡中打开它们. 我怎样才能做到这一点? 提前致谢.解决方法:你可以这样做:function newWindow_method_1() {var wi = window.open();var html = $('.mainservice-page').html();$(wi.document.body).html(html); } OR function newWindow_method_2() {var html = $...
一、实现原理 1、主要运用“排他思想”,在设置当前元素前,先把相应元素恢复到默认状态 2、给相应元素添加下标的应用 二、代码展示 <!DOCTYPE html> <html> <head> <title></title> <style type="text/css"> *{margin: 0;padding: 0;} ul,li{ list-style: none; } ul{display: block;overflow: hidden; clear: both;} li{display:block;float: left; width: 200px; height: 40px;line-height: 40px; text-align: center; backgr...
本教程通过js面向对象的方法来封装一个选项卡的实例,在实例中讲解js的面向对象如何实现功能。 一般封装好的选项卡程序,只需要一个div元素即可。其它元素都是通过json数据来生成,所以封装好的选项卡实例,调用非常方便。先创建一个div元素,如下所示:本教程不过多解释面向对象的前世今生,直接通过实例说明具体的做法。先准备好需要的json数据,等下就可以直接在实例中生成选项卡。数据代码如下所示: 复制代码 var oData = [ {...